How to fill out a-14 radiation laboratory close-out

How to fill out a-14 radiation laboratory close-out:
01
Gather all necessary documentation related to the radiation laboratory, including records of experiments conducted, equipment used, and any incidents or accidents that occurred.
02
Review the laboratory's radiation safety procedures and guidelines to ensure that all necessary information is included in the close-out form.
03
Begin filling out the form by providing basic information such as the laboratory's name, location, and contact information.
04
Specify the dates during which the laboratory was operational and the reason for the close-out.
05
Provide a detailed inventory of the radiation sources present in the laboratory, including their type, quantity, and any activities conducted using them.
06
Document any incidents or accidents that occurred during the laboratory's operation, including the date, nature of the event, and any resulting actions taken to address the situation.
07
Indicate any waste generated during the laboratory's operations and describe how it was managed and disposed of properly.
08
Include information about any equipment used in the laboratory, including the manufacturer, model number, and any maintenance or calibration records.
09
Outline any training and certification requirements for individuals working in the radiation laboratory and include records or documentation of their qualifications.
10
Finally, ensure that all necessary signatures and approvals are obtained before submitting the completed a-14 radiation laboratory close-out form.

What is a-14 radiation laboratory close-out?
A-14 radiation laboratory close-out is a formal process to decommission and report the status of a laboratory that has ceased operations involving radioactive materials. It ensures that all radioactive materials are properly disposed of, and the laboratory is returned to a safe state.
Who is required to file a-14 radiation laboratory close-out?
The principal investigator or laboratory supervisor responsible for the radiation laboratory is required to file the A-14 radiation laboratory close-out. Institutions or organizations that manage the laboratories may also have policies in place regarding these filings.
How to fill out a-14 radiation laboratory close-out?
To fill out the A-14 radiation laboratory close-out form, you must provide detailed information about inventory, waste disposal, equipment decontamination, and confirm that all radioactive materials have been removed or properly disposed of. Follow the specific instructions provided by the regulatory authority overseeing radiation safety.
What is the purpose of a-14 radiation laboratory close-out?
The purpose of the A-14 radiation laboratory close-out is to ensure public safety and environmental protection by confirming that all radioactive materials have been correctly managed and that the laboratory is decommissioned according to regulatory standards.
What information must be reported on a-14 radiation laboratory close-out?
The information that must be reported includes a complete inventory of all radioactive materials, details of their disposal, documentation of decontamination efforts, and certifications of compliance with safety regulations.
